Solution for 34242 is what percent of 71502:

34242:71502*100 =

(34242*100):71502 =

3424200:71502 = 47.89

Now we have: 34242 is what percent of 71502 = 47.89

Question: 34242 is what percent of 71502?

Percentage solution with steps:

Step 1: We make the assumption that 71502 is 100% since it is our output value.

Step 2: We next represent the value we seek with {x}.

Step 3: From step 1, it follows that {100\%}={71502}.

Step 4: In the same vein, {x\%}={34242}.

Step 5: This gives us a pair of simple equations:

{100\%}={71502}(1).

{x\%}={34242}(2).

Step 6: By simply dividing equation 1 by equation 2 and taking note of the fact that both the LHS
(left hand side) of both equations have the same unit (%); we have

\frac{100\%}{x\%}=\frac{71502}{34242}

Step 7: Taking the inverse (or reciprocal) of both sides yields

\frac{x\%}{100\%}=\frac{34242}{71502}

\Rightarrow{x} = {47.89\%}

Therefore, {34242} is {47.89\%} of {71502}.
